MCO Legals elevates Anju Bansal to Senior Partner, Tannishtha Singh to Partner

The firm has also elevated Abinash Agarwal and Paramita Banerjee to Legal Heads.

MCO Legals (Meharia & Company) has announced the promotion of Anju Bansal to the position of Senior Partner and Tannishtha Singh to the position of Partner.

Bansal, graduate of University of Mumbai, has been associated with the Real Estate and Due Diligence division of the firm for its clientele across all branches. Additionally, Bansal also overlooks the HR Division of MCO.

Singh, a graduate of ILS Pune, specialises in civil litigation, commercial arbitration, legal due diligence and statutory compliances.

The Firm has also promoted Abinash Agarwal and Paramita Banerjee to Legal Heads.

Agarwal, graduate of Faculty of Law, University of Delhi specialises in civil litigation, commercial arbitration, legal due diligence and legal compliances.

Banerjee, graduate of School of Law, Christ University specialises in civil litigation and corporate & commercial arbitration.

Managing Partner of MCO Legals, Amit Meharia offered his warmest congratulations to Bansal, Singh, Agarwal, and Banerjee for their exceptional professionalism and dedication towards the firm and in rendering legal service.
